Eligibility
Inclusion criteria
Inclusion criteria: 1) Age equal to or more than 20 years old 2) Patients with established HFpEF or subjects who are suspected of HFpEF 3) Subjects who are treated with a pre-specified minimum dose of beta-blockers 5) Subjects who are able to keep cycle ergometry exercise (0 watts) for more than 30 seconds 6) Patients who give written consent to participate in this study
Exclusion criteria
Exclusion criteria: 1) Patients with mimic HFpEF: More than mild aortic or mitral valve stenosis, more than moderate aortic or mitral valve regurgitation, history of left ventricular ejection fraction less than 40%, non-group II pulmonary hypertension, hypertrophic cardiomyopathy (except for apical hypertrophic cardiomyopathy), cardiac sarcoidosis, constrictive pericardititis 2) Patients with comorbidities contraindicated for exercise testing: acute decompensated heart failure, acute coronary syndrome, severe coronary artery disease 3) Patients who are expected to have disadvantages in discontinuing beta-blockers: History of old myocardial infarction, presence of obvious myocardial ischemia, appearance of new wall motion abnormality during exercise, history of hospitalization due to tachyarrhythmia within 6 months, Basedow's disease 4) Patients who cannot exercise their legs due to abnormalities in joints, muscles, etc. 4) Patients who are judged to be unsuitable for th e study by the investigators
Design outcomes
Primary
| Measure | Time frame |
|---|---|
| Change in peak oxygen consumption during exercise stress echocardiography from baseline to four-weeks after the intervention | — |
Secondary
| Measure | Time frame |
|---|---|
| *Changes in the following parameters from baseline to four-weeks after the intervention will be assessed: Heart rate during peak exercise Cardiac output during peak exercise Mitral s' during peak exercise GLS during peak exercise VE/VCO2 slope NT-proBNP levels *The following prognostic data will be also assessed: Time to first heart failure hospitalization Time to all-cause mortality Time to cardiac death Time to first heart failure hospitalization or all-cause mortality Time to first heart failure hospitalization or cardiac death | — |
